A sodium-chloride spring from the Ninotaira source. The wellhead runs at 84 °C — among Japan's hottest natural sources — and is diluted with water to bring the bath down to 40–42 °C, with the salt content carrying long-lasting warmth. Weakly alkaline (pH 8.3) and soft on the skin, the water is unusually rich in metasilicic acid at 272 mg/kg, leaving the kind of thin silica film that makes skin feel noticeably smoother afterwards.

Warming
Salt forms a film on the skin that slows heat loss, so the warmth lingers long after the bath (the classic heat-keeping water, nettō 熱の湯).

Smooth skin
Bicarbonate and alkalinity gently lift dead keratin while silica hydrates, leaving skin smooth. This is the basis of the beautifying-water (bijin-no-yu 美人の湯) reputation.
